
Colored hair requires special attention to maintain its shine and prevent premature fading of the color. Over time and due to external aggressors such as the sun, pollution, chlorine, and frequent washing, the color pigments can gradually lose their intensity. To keep the vibrancy of the shade and the health of your hair, adopting a suitable care routine is essential. This routine includes using products specifically formulated for colored hair, nourishing masks, UV protective treatments, and tips for spacing out shampoos while preserving the color’s brilliance.

Sun protection during sun exposure is fundamental for colored hair. UV rays, formidable bleaching agents, threaten the intensity of the pigments. Consider protective sprays or veils with UV filters to preserve the depth of your color. Similarly, in the presence of chlorinated water, opt for swim caps or apply a protective mask before swimming to avoid discoloration.
The use of heated styling tools, while convenient, can be risky without the barrier of adequate heat protection. High temperatures can not only dry out the hair fiber but also alter the color. Before using a hairdryer, straightener, or curling iron, apply a product designed to protect your hair from heat to maintain lasting shine.

Products specifically designed for colored hair form a barrier against daily aggressions. Sulfate-free shampoos and conditioners, intensive hair masks, nourishing oils, and repigmenting treatments should be prioritized. They help hydrate, nourish, and revive the color, giving it longevity and radiance. The frequency of washes should also be moderated: occasional use of dry shampoos can help space out washes while maintaining the vitality of the color.
